For two populations to evolve into two species that look different, what must happen?

A form of speciation, whether it is allopatric speciation, which is the separation of a population by a physical barrier i.e. a dam wall, or sympatric speciation, which is the separation of a population but not by physical barriers, needs to happen for a population to evolve into different species
